Banks Charge Premium for Lax Cybersecurity

Lax cybersecurity can cost your business dearly - in fact, academic studies show that firms with weak security postures may pay up to ten extra basis points on loans, translating into hundreds of thousands of dollars in additional borrowing costs. That's a hefty premium for failing to prioritize cybersecurity.

Law Enforcement Disrupts $45 Million Global Cryptocurrency Scam

In a major breakthrough, law enforcement agencies in the US, UK, and Canada joined forces to disrupt a massive $45 million global cryptocurrency scam, freezing $12 million in stolen funds and identifying over 20,000 linked wallet addresses. This significant action not only recovered funds for victims but also shed light on the darker side of digital cash and the challenges of accountability in the crypto world.
